Program areas at Ulster Home Health Services
Certified Home Health agencyin 2020, the uhhs/chha served 285 patients with 4,182 visits.the certified Home Health agency (chha) offered skilled, part time Services to patients in need of rehabilitation, skilled nursing and observation and teaching to restore them to their previous level of functioning, if possible. Many patients come directly from a hospital setting, or they may be discharged to the chha from a skilled nursing facility, where they have already gone through some rehabilitation and skilled care. Patients also may be referred directly from their provider, who notes they need something additional in the Home setting to help them with strength, some sort of healing or education, medication management, or some other skilled Services on a temporary basis. The chha offers skilled nursing Services from rns and lpns, physical, occupational and speech therapy, nutritionist Services, social worker Services, and Home Health aide help in the Home. Most chha cases are short term, with the goal of getting the patient back to the most independent level possible. The chha contracts with medicare, medicaid, all managed plans for both, work comp cases, no fault, or commercial insurance for skilled patient care. Most of the work done by clinicians involve close monitoring of patient status through frequent visits, other clinician and aide visits, and regular discussions with the provider in the community, who orders the care. The objective of the program in most cases is to keep the patient safe at Home, and restore them to as close to the previous level of functioning as possible. A few patients in the program stay on for years, as to discharge them would lead to a decrease in their level of functioning.
